Toppy Seeds.
46
By an arrangement entered into between the British
Government and the Goverment of Chino, when revising the
Customs teriff of Chins which onme in force in August. 1919, the British Government agreed that the importation of poppy seeds would be prohibited (vide Tariff Rule 4). Nevertheless the Indian Government has spparently taken no steps to prohibit the direct exportation of such poppS seeds to ūkinu. Recently a parcel of poppy seeda posted in India and clearly marked "yoppy seeda" was couspted for transmission and was about to be delivered to the Japanese addresses in Tientsin when the China Justoma ssised the parcel in question. The shipment was by MBK end the addressee was MBK Tientsin. Recently a shipment of some five tons of poppy seeds which rençasć ühina destined for the province of Hunan would strongly appear to be of Indian origin. The recorda of seizuren made by
the Chinese Customa show that in many instances consigamenta of Indian poppy seeds have been seized in the Southern
ports of China.
